Building Access — Temporary Site (Renovation Period). While the Halloway Court offices are under renovation, all teams at Tindermark Systems relocate to the temporary site at Orrel Quay, floors 2 and 3. Team assistants should brief their groups: the lobby opens at 07:30, deliveries go to the rear dock, and meeting rooms are bookable as usual. The side entrance on Orrel Quay is keypad-controlled and uses the code below.

door code, yagag-yajog: bdg-PO-2

**Q: Why do some invoices from Papertrail Render come out with squished tables?**

Short version: the new layout engine (Quillpress) measures fonts differently than the old one, so legacy templates with hardcoded column widths can collapse. Fix is to switch templates to flex columns — takes about five minutes per template. Anything generated after the Tuesday deploy is fine. Step-by-step migration instructions live on the internal page here.

wiki page, tahaf-tajog: https://jira.ordindyn.corp/pipeline

Q3 Planning — Vellmark Tools Line

Finance: list prices on the Vellmark hand-tool range rise 4% effective quarter start. Discount ceilings unchanged; channel rebates capped at 6%. Margin target moves to 41%. Expect modest volume dip in the Torvale region, offset by the Halden bundle launch. Detail on the repositioning follows below.

confidential, bafog-tafog: The renewal with Zorathek Group closes at $5 million a year, 10 percent below the last contract. Project Zorwyn slips by a full year because of the staffing delay.

## Fan-out rework for storm alerts

This PR changes how Cloudwren distributes weather alerts to regional subscriber shards. Previously one worker pushed to all shards serially, which caused delays during the Marleth Valley flood drills. Now a dispatcher fans out to a bounded worker pool with per-shard retry budgets. Nothing changes in the alert payload format, so downstream consumers are unaffected. The pool sizing and retry knobs used in this change are listed below.

limits module of fajog-tawig:
RATE_LIMITS = {
    "druwyn": 2,
    "quenael": 10,
    "wenix": 2,
    "druael": 2,
}